http://www.knowledgebank.irri.org/ricebreedingcourse/Lesson_8_Correlations_among_traits__implications_for_screening.htm WebJul 18, 2024 · The genotypic and environmental main effects of the Finlay-Wilkinson (FW) model were highly significant (P < = 0.001) for all observed traits . Significant differences in regression slope (sensitivity) among genotypes on the environmental mean was found for all traits except dry matter content . WebGenotypic effects of rs4149056 polymorphism in Caucasians indicated that statin users who carried CC and TC genotypes had a significantly higher risk of myopathy than those who carried TT genotype, with a pooled odds ratio (OR) of 2.9 (95% confidence interval, 1.59, 5.34) and 1.6 (1.20, 2.16), respectively. foto könig mindelheim
